Abstract

The motifs on the typical Troso Jepara ikat weaving have unique shapes and patterns and have references in their design. Besides being designed according to beauty, the motifs on the Troso ikat also have their own philosophical and mathematical values. This research was conducted with the aim of describing the mathematical ideas contained in the troso ikat motif as well as the philosophical ones contained in the culture. The method in this study uses a qualitative research method with an ethnographic approach. Data collection techniques in the study were carried out directly in the field to find information by observation, interviews, and documentation. The informant in this study was Mr. Muhammad Habib as the owner of the Troso “Aida” Ikat Weaving business in Jepara, Central Java. The instruments in this study were observation sheets, interview sheets, and field documentation. Data analysis techniques used in this study are domain analysis and taxonomic analysis. The results of this study indicate that there are mathematical ideas with nuances of two-dimensional geometry in several Jepara Troso Ikat Weaving motifs including gill motifs, re-woven motifs, baron motifs feather motifs, and lurik motifs. The geometric concept in the troso ikat motif is in the form of a flat wake concept including rectangles, rhombuses, isosceles triangles, triangles, circles, hexagons, and parallelograms

Abstract

Mathematics with cultural nuances is often found in batik. Batik Mlatiharjan is a center for making Demak typical batik which is located in the village of Mlatiharjo, Gajah District, Demak Regency. There are two types of Mlatiharjan batik, namely written batik and stamped batik. Mlatiharjan batik has become part of Demak culture. Researchers can relate the Mlatiharjan batik with the geometric concept of a flat shape. This study used an exploratory qualitative descriptive ethnographic methodology. The ethnomathematics elements in the various motifs of Mlatiharjan batik are the objects of this research. Mrs. Kusmidarmini, the owner of a batik center, is a cultural expert as the subject of this study. Exploration, observation, interviews, and documentation are part of the data collection method. The aim of the Mlatiharjan batik research is to determine the mathematical and philosophical values of the Mlatiharjan batik motifs. The results of this study indicate that each motif has a philosophical meaning and a geometric geometric concept. The motifs include the Guava Flower Motif, Sidomukti Mosque Bledeg, Champa Plate, Demak Great Mosque, Red Guava, Guava Tree, Belimbing Guava, Fish Coral, Demak Crown, and Sidomukti Jambu Bulus Motif. Mathematical concepts that have been found in the variety of batik motifs from Demak, namely geometric shapes such as circles, squares, rectangles, triangles, rhombuses, and trapezoids. Abstract

Monotonous and conventional learning using the lecture method can cause students to be less interested in learning. This causes the concept given not to imprint sharply in the memory of students so that students easily forget and often confused in solving a problem that is different from what is exemplified by the teacher. The purpose of this study is for the feasibility, effectiveness, and development of snakes and ladders media with a Realistic Mathematics Education model on understanding mathematical concepts. In this study, research and development (R&D) research methods were used. This research will be carried out in grade IV SDN Tambirejo with research subjects of 10 students and teachers. The subject selection of 10 students was obtained from the postest and prettest assessments. For teachers, an assessment was obtained from the results of interviews between researchers and teachers. The dependent variable in this study is understanding the concept, while the independent variable is a Realistic Mathematics Education model assisted by two snakes and ladders. Data collection techniques include interviews, observations, tests, and documentation. The data analysis used is qualitative and quantitative data analysis. The results of this study show that Snakes and Ladders media is very feasible to use, shown by the percentage of media feasibility of 77% and material feasibility of 88%. The N-Gain test showed a result of 0.1785 with the "medium" category. The conclusion in this study is that the Snakes and Ladders media is declared feasible and effective for use in grade IV learning of Wide Material Maematics Lessons and flat build circumference.
